The owners kept the existing layout of their kitchen, but to create a better sense of flow they installed a central island unit which has become the focal point of the new modern kitchen. The family-friendly island unit houses the sink, storage cupboards, shelves, extra worktop space plus a breakfast bar area.

Modern kitchen with open-plan dining area
The layout was designed to create zones for cooking, eating and relaxing, with the island unit as the central hub. To give the multifunctional space a simple feel, the colour palette was kept neutral throughout with pops of bright primary colour added here and there on pendant lights and accessories.

Neutral kitchen with streamlined cabinets
Rather than installing base drawers, the owners opted for cupboards to make it easier to locate cookware and utensils. Wall cabinets above balance the look whilst maintaining a neutral colour scheme. Appliances are integrated to create a seamless, uncluttered look.

Contemporary kitchen with polished concrete work surfaces
The worktops are made of polished concrete to give an industrial look, with the added bonus of being extremely durable and easy to maintain. Handle-less drawers ensure that nothing interrupts the streamlined look of the kitchen units.

The kitchen before the makeover
Before the owners over-hauled the kitchen it was gloomy and dated, with scruffy white cabinets, poor lighting and old-fashioned doors. The makeover has transformed it into a light, contemporary space that looks stylish and is perfectly suited to family living.
